An Interesting Class of Hankel Determinants [PDF]
For small $r$ the Hankel determinants $d_r(n)$ of the sequence $\left({2n+r\choose n}\right)_{n\ge 0}$ are easy to guess and show an interesting modular pattern. For arbitrary $r$ and $n$ no closed formulae are known, but for each positive integer $r$ the special values $d_r(rn)$, $d_r(rn+1)$, and $d_r(rn+\lfloor\frac{r+1}{2}\rfloor)$ have nice values ...

An equivalence result for VC classes of sets [PDF]
Let R and θ be infinite sets and let A # R × θ. We show that the class of projections of A onto R is a Vapnik–Chervonenkis (VC) class of sets if and only if the class of projections of A onto θ is a VC class.

An interesting class of C1 foliations
The authors describe a class of depth two foliations in which certain growth conditions allow \(C^1\)-smoothability, but obstruct higher order smoothability. As a result, there exist uncountably many examples of \(C^1\)-foliations that are not homeomorphic to \(C^2\)-foliations, as well as uncountably many \(C^0\)-foliations that are not homeomorphic ...
